India's star pacer Arshdeep Singh has been named ICC Men's T20I cricketer of the year 2024 following his back-to-back stellar performances in the shortest format of the game.

Arshdeep Singh takes away T20I cricketer of the year award

Arshdeep Singh played an instrumental role in India's T20 World Cup 2024 title triumph in the Caribbean and USA. Arshdeep was a force to reckon with in the marquee tournament in which India ended their 11-year-long drought of ICC Trophy by clinching the title. Arshdeep's performance solidified his reputation as a premier powerplay and death overs specialist in the T20 format.

The 25-year-old left-arm pacer has consistently shown immense promise, earning the trust and confidence of the Indian team since his international debut in 2022.

The year 2024 proved to be a breakthrough year for Arshdeep, firmly establishing him as a world-class T20I bowler. He consistently claimed crucial wickets with the new ball and maintained exceptional economy rates in the death overs across diverse pitches.

Arshdeep Singh emerged as India's leading wicket-taker in T20 Internationals during the year, claiming an impressive 36 wickets in just 18 matches. His outstanding performances played a crucial role in India's triumphant T20 World Cup campaign. As the selectors embarked on building a new era for the T20 squad following this victory, Arshdeep stepped up as a leader of the attack.

Only four bowlers worldwide surpassed Arshdeep's wicket tally in 2024: Usman Najeeb (Saudi Arabia), Wanindu Hasaranga (Sri Lanka), Junaid Siddique (UAE), and Ehsan Khan (Hong Kong). Notably, Hasaranga was the only bowler from a full-member nation to achieve a higher wicket count. However, all four of these bowlers played more matches than Arshdeep.

Despite primarily operating in the high-pressure situations of the powerplay and death overs, Arshdeep maintained an impressive economy rate of 7.49. He consistently posed a significant wicket-taking threat, achieving a remarkable strike rate of 10.80 and an average of just 15.31.

Arshdeep Singh displayed several impressive performances throughout the year, none more remarkable than his spell against the USA during the T20 World Cup group stage in New York. He delivered a devastating performance, claiming 4 wickets for just 9 runs in his four overs.

However, Arshdeep's best show arguably came on the grandest stage of all: the T20 World Cup Final in Barbados. He played a crucial role in helping India successfully defend their target of 176.

As part of a formidable pace trio alongside Jasprit Bumrah and Hardik Pandya, who collectively guided India to victory, Arshdeep's outstanding figures of 2/20 in four overs only partially reflect his immense impact on the match.

Recently, Arshdeep became India's leading wicket taker in T20Is. In the first T20I against England, Arshdeep Singh notched two wickets to surpass Yuzvendra Chahal to become Indian bowler with most T20I scalps.
